OVO Hoodies and Personal Branding
Drake’s hoodies are often from his own brand, October’s Very Own (OVO). Featuring the iconic owl logo, OVO hoodies are sleek, premium, and subtle. Whether it’s black with gold embroidery or white with tonal designs, these hoodies represent more than just merch—they represent a lifestyle. Wearing an OVO hoodie is like wearing part of Drake’s personality: successful, smooth, and loyal to his Toronto roots. These hoodies have become staples in both streetwear culture and celebrity fashion.
